The Communications Executive role reports to the Head of Internal Communications, working closely across the small Brand & Communications team in a matrix fashion, with an opportunity to actively contribute to brand, external and internal communications.
Halma’s Brand & Communications team is based in the UK, with members in the US, India and China. This is an opportunity for a purpose-driven individual with excellent attention to detail to join a small, high-performing team and help one of Britain’s Most Admired Companies tell its story to the people that matter most to its continued success.
Halma operates an integrated communications model spanning content & brand, external communications and internal communications. The team’s purpose is to:
- Tell the Halma story with clear and consistent messages to our key audiences: prospective talent, potential acquisitions, investors, and employees.
- Attract the right talent and engage employees with compelling content delivered through digital platforms and major events.
- Attract and engage new acquisitions through targeted campaigns and high quality content.
- Attract and engage investors through results content, ARA, and webinars.
- Provide strategic communications support to our companies to help them grow.

How to prepare for a job interview at Halma p.l.c
✨Know the Company Inside Out
Before your interview, take some time to research Halma and its mission. Understand their commitment to creating a safer, cleaner, and healthier future. This will not only help you answer questions more effectively but also show your genuine interest in the role.
✨Showcase Your Communication Skills
As a Communications Executive, your ability to convey messages clearly is crucial. Prepare examples of past work where you crafted compelling content or managed communications effectively. Be ready to discuss how you adapt your style for different audiences.
✨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ions
Expect questions that assess your problem-solving skills and adaptability. Think of scenarios where you've had to manage multiple stakeholders or deliver projects under tight deadlines.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ses.
✨Emphasise Your Teamwork and Collaboration
Halma values a collaborative environment, so be prepared to discuss how you've worked with diverse teams in the past. Highlight your ability to build trust and align stakeholders, as well as any experience you have in cross-functional projects.
